GeorgianCollege.ca/CVTY CIVIL ENGINEERING TECHNOLOGY CO-OP CVTY This program is scheduled to take advantage of typical Canadian construction seasons. Graduates are prepared to work with engineers, designers and construction project managers as an integral part of the team. Students are exposed to three program principles: 1) proposal development (construction of roads, bridges, sewers, water mains and other infrastructure) 2) cost estimation 3) field work (materials testing and project administration). The use of the latest codes and standards, site management techniques and related computer technologies, along with integrated work placement experiences, equip graduates to succeed in this rapidly evolving and growing industry. GeorgianCollege.ca/ARTE ARCHITECTURAL TECHNOLOGY CO-OP ARTE This program prepares graduate technologists to work with architects, engineers, designers and project managers as an integral part of the team developing, presenting and executing building designs. The program equips students with comprehensive understanding of current competitive architectural/construction environments that challenge professionals in the field, including mastering the latest codes and standards, site management techniques and computer technologies.
